DIY - Chopsticks & Fortune Cookies as Favors

This DIY gift package would make a nice favor or parting gift and includes a set of bamboo chopsticks and a paper fortune cookie. A simple, inexpensive and unique gift!


This project is super easy. Here are the details so you can make one yourself...

Materials:
Origami, Scrapbook, or Colored Paper for fortune cookie and tab top
White Paper for fortune saying - 3/4"W x 4"L
Chopsticks (I got mine at Daiso... 12 sets for a $1.50... or try the dollar store)
Faux Floral sprigs
Ribbon
Glue Dots
Green floral tape
Biodegradable Clear Bag - approx size 4.25"W x 9.75"H

Instructions:
1) Make paper fortune cookie. Great instructions here. You can use a CD spindle to trace a circle, and glue dots to keep the cookie closed. Insert fortune saying.

2) Assemble chopsticks.Take a floral sprig and center it over the pair of chopsticks. Wrap floral tape snuggly around both. Finish with a nice ribbon bow.

3) Insert into clear bag. Slide in the fortune cookie first. Use chopsticks to push into place. Slide in the chopsticks at an angle. Cut a folded rectangle to fit over the bag opening like a clamshell. Staple to seal bag. You can write "Thank You" or a Name/Note on the tab.

4) Give to someone special!

Candy Friday - Bella Umbrella - Bridal Bouquet Alternative

As a soon to be bride and floral designer, Jodell wanted to do something distinctive instead of renting a traditional white tent for her outdoor wedding ceremony. She procured 75 vintage umbrellas for her guests in the event there were showers on her wedding day. Each guest would be offered a beautiful umbrella from the 1920' s-1940. Later the umbrellas would create a brilliant backdrop to the happy day. It was the beginning of a beautiful marriage in more ways than one.

Continuing to collect umbrellas, Jodell launched the Bella Umbrella website in 2001. Her personal collection of 100 vintage umbrellas was now available for rent to brides all over the world. Since then Jodell has designed and developed two unique umbrella collections; Vintage Bella and Signature Bella as well as inventing and patenting the Bixi; an adaptor that quickly converts a Signature Bella umbrella handle into a stunning bouquet holder.

Bella Umbrella vintage umbrellas can be rented for $10 to $30 each depending on the umbrellas selected. This is a budget friendly alternative to the traditional bridal bouquet and looks wonderful in pictures.

DIY - Bling on the Centerpieces

Here’s a pretty and budget friendly project for a table centerpiece. Add a little sparkle to your wedding day and create a dazzling floral centerpiece using glass, some beads, and fresh flowers. Take this initial idea and make it your own. These vases can be customized to any size, shape, and color. These vases make fantastic centerpieces for weddings, showers, and other celebratory occasions. Or just make one for your own pleasure and enjoyment.


Measure and cut elastic thread to a length that will encircle glass, plus several inches to tie off. Thread first group of beads on elastic thread, test for fit and tie off. Now you can pre-cut a number of pieces of thread and continue threading until vase is completely covered.


Fill vase two-thirds full with water and floral preservative. Cut stems of flowers (lisianthus are used here) to correct length so that the flowers sit just at the top of the rim of the glass. Continue until the vase is full.

David's Bridal Says "I Do" to NYC!

On March 5, 2009, David's Bridal opened their first store in New York City. Located the heart of Manhattan’s Flat Iron district, 751 Sixth Avenue, West side, between 24th and 25th Streets. Cindy Payne, SVP of Stores for David’s Bridal and New York City Commissioner Robert Walsh were present to take part in ribbon cutting ceremony signifying the noteworthy arrival.

According to the annual “What’s on Brides’ Minds” survey, conducted by Infosurv, Inc. for David’s Bridal, three-quarters (75%) of brides-to-be admit that they will have to make adjustments to their wedding budget as a result of the economic climate. About one quarter plan to cut their budget in half and one in ten said their budget had dropped more than 75%. Amidst troubling economic times, a wedding is still the most important day in a couple’s life. David’s is proud to offer beautiful bridal gowns at exceptional value, so that brides can stay within their budget, without compromising quality or style.

David's extensive selection of elegant bridal gowns ranges in price from $299 to $1,200 – including designer gowns from Oleg Cassini and Galina Signature – making luxury affordable, a welcome option in today’s economy. The company also offers a wide selection of fashionable, yet affordable, bridal party attire, accessories, special occasion and prom attire, ensuring every woman looks her best, no matter what her event or budget.
